As Pipeline Production Soars in Minnesota, Critics Urge Focus Safety

2014-06-20 06:00:00| Climate Ark Climate Change & Global Warming Newsfeed

MPR: Every day, about 2.3 million barrels of crude oil crosses Minnesota through 10 pipelines, and eight trains carry another 500,000 barrels. Eight of the pipelines are operated by Enbridge Energy and the other two by the Koch Pipeline Company, which transports 465,000 barrels a day to the Twin Cities through its MinnCan line.
